2. Various Kinds Of On-line Poker Ranking Systems:
Today, players get access to different online poker ranking methods that use diverse methodologies in evaluating players' performances. While some systems give attention to cash online game outcomes, others prioritize event accomplishments or a variety of both.
One popular ranking system could be the Global Poker Index (GPI), which gained widespread recognition because impartial and precise evaluation techniques. The GPI uses a scoring formula that weighs tournaments' buy-ins, area dimensions, and players' finishing roles. Consequently, the device presents an objective position that ranks people according to their constant performance in prestigious live tournaments.
Additionally, online systems including PocketFives and Sharkscope offer ratings considering players' on line event activities solely. These platforms monitor people' results across multiple online poker sites, permitting people to compare their overall performance against other individuals into the internet poker neighborhood.
3. Implications of On-line Poker Ranking:
Internet poker ranking systems have actually manifold implications for players, operators, plus the total poker neighborhood. Firstly, these methods foster competition, as people attempt to climb within the rankings ladder, eventually enhancing the entire ability of this player pool. Also, ranking methods motivate people to improve their particular game play, research methods, and dedicate longer and effort to on-line poker.
For operators, internet poker ranking systems act as an advertising device to attract more people. By highlighting the accomplishments of high-ranking players in on line tournaments, operators can make a good community and create a competitive environment that motivates involvement.
However, it is very important to notice that on-line poker ranking systems are not without their particular limitations. The methods primarily target people' tournament performances and will maybe not precisely mirror their overall skills in most poker variations. Additionally, some people may manipulate their particular ranks by playing selective tournaments or exploiting the machine's defects, undermining the competitive stability of internet poker.
